Common workflow challenges across academic and administrative operations
Many education institutions face similar operational bottlenecks regardless of size. Admissions data may sit in one system while fee records are maintained elsewhere. Faculty contracts and payroll adjustments may depend on manual HR coordination. Procurement requests for classroom supplies, lab equipment, or IT assets may move through email chains with limited accountability. Maintenance teams may receive facility issues informally, making response times inconsistent. Leadership often receives delayed reporting because finance, operations, and student-facing teams are not working from synchronized data.
- Disconnected workflows between admissions, finance, HR, procurement, and facilities
- Manual processes for approvals, fee tracking, vendor coordination, and document handling
- Delayed reporting that limits budget control and operational decision-making
- Duplicate data entry across student records, billing, payroll, and service requests
- Poor visibility into procurement status, inventory usage, and campus maintenance activity
- Inconsistent workflows across departments or campuses that complicate governance
- Scaling limitations when enrollment growth outpaces administrative capacity
- Weak forecasting for staffing, procurement, cash flow, and resource utilization
These issues are not only administrative inconveniences. They affect student experience, faculty productivity, compliance readiness, and financial control. An institution may attract more applicants but still struggle operationally if admissions handoffs, invoicing, onboarding, and scheduling remain fragmented. How Odoo ERP supports education workflow management
Odoo ERP can be configured to support the operational backbone of education organizations by connecting front-office and back-office functions in one platform. While academic delivery models vary by institution, the administrative architecture is often highly suitable for standardization. Odoo CRM can support inquiry and admissions pipeline management. Sales can structure application-related services, enrollment packages, or training program offerings where relevant. Accounting manages invoicing, receivables, budgeting, and financial reporting. HR and Planning support faculty and staff administration. Purchase, Inventory, and Documents improve procurement and internal controls. Helpdesk and Field Service can be adapted for student service desks, IT support, and campus maintenance workflows. Website and Ecommerce can support digital forms, program information, event registration, and online service requests.
For institutions with labs, hostels, transport operations, bookstores, cafeterias, or distributed campuses, Odoo also provides a practical foundation for inventory control, vendor management, maintenance scheduling, and service coordination. The result is a more connected operating environment where each department contributes to a unified data model instead of maintaining isolated records.

Realistic business scenario: multi-campus college group
Consider a multi-campus college group operating undergraduate programs, short-term certifications, and continuing education services. Each campus manages admissions inquiries separately, finance teams reconcile fee records manually, procurement is decentralized, and facility issues are reported through email or messaging apps. Leadership lacks a consolidated view of applicant conversion, overdue receivables, vendor commitments, staffing utilization, and maintenance backlog. During enrollment peaks, administrative teams become overloaded and response times deteriorate.
In this scenario, an Odoo ERP implementation can establish a centralized admissions pipeline in CRM, standardize applicant document collection through Documents, automate billing and payment tracking in Accounting, and route procurement through Purchase with approval controls. Inventory can manage IT equipment, lab consumables, and campus supplies. HR and Planning can coordinate faculty contracts and support staffing. Helpdesk and Maintenance can formalize campus service requests and preventive maintenance schedules. The institution gains a shared operating model while still allowing campus-level execution within defined governance rules.
This type of deployment is especially valuable when education groups are expanding through new campuses, new programs, or acquisitions. Without process standardization, growth often multiplies inconsistency. With a cloud ERP platform and disciplined workflow design, institutions can scale with stronger control over service levels, financial operations, and operational reporting.
Implementation guidance for education ERP modernization
Education ERP projects succeed when institutions treat implementation as an operating model redesign rather than a software installation. The first step is process discovery across admissions, finance, HR, procurement, facilities, and service operations. This should identify where approvals stall, where data is re-entered, which reports are manually assembled, and which workflows vary by campus or department. From there, the implementation team can define a target-state process architecture that balances standardization with necessary institutional flexibility.
A practical Odoo implementation roadmap often begins with finance, procurement, document control, and admissions workflow visibility because these areas create immediate operational value. HR, Planning, Helpdesk, Maintenance, and broader service workflows can then be phased in. Data migration should focus on quality and governance, not just volume. Institutions should define ownership for applicant records, vendor masters, employee data, chart of accounts, asset lists, and document structures before go-live. Role-based access, approval matrices, and audit trails are especially important in education environments where financial control, privacy, and policy compliance matter.
- Map current-state workflows before configuring modules
- Standardize approval rules for procurement, finance, HR, and service requests
- Define master data ownership across campuses and departments
- Phase implementation by operational priority instead of deploying everything at once
- Train users by role with scenario-based workflows rather than generic system demos
- Establish post-go-live governance for process changes, reporting, and user adoption
Workflow automation opportunities in education operations
Workflow automation in education should focus on repetitive, approval-heavy, and time-sensitive processes. Admissions teams can automate inquiry assignment, follow-up reminders, document collection requests, and application stage updates. Finance teams can automate invoice generation, payment reminders, reconciliation tasks, and approval routing for refunds or adjustments. Procurement teams can automate purchase requisitions, budget checks, vendor comparison workflows, and goods receipt confirmations. HR can automate onboarding checklists, contract renewals, leave approvals, and employee document management.
Support operations also benefit significantly. Helpdesk workflows can route student, faculty, or staff requests to the right team based on issue type, campus, or urgency. Maintenance can trigger preventive work orders for HVAC systems, lab equipment, classroom assets, and transport vehicles. Documents can automate policy acknowledgments, contract approvals, and controlled record retention. These automations reduce administrative burden while improving consistency and accountability across departments.
Cloud ERP considerations for schools, colleges, and training institutions
Cloud ERP deployment is increasingly relevant for education organizations that need multi-campus access, centralized governance, lower infrastructure overhead, and easier scalability. A cloud-hosted Odoo environment can support distributed admissions teams, finance users, faculty administrators, and support staff through secure browser-based access. It also simplifies updates, backup management, and environment standardization compared with fragmented on-premise systems.
However, cloud ERP decisions should be made with operational and governance requirements in mind. Institutions should evaluate data residency expectations, access controls, backup policies, disaster recovery, integration architecture, and performance requirements during peak periods such as admissions cycles, fee deadlines, and semester transitions. A reliable Odoo hosting partner can help define environment sizing, security controls, staging practices, and support procedures that align with institutional risk management. For education groups with multiple entities or campuses, cloud architecture should also support shared services while preserving entity-level reporting and approval boundaries.

Operational governance and best practices
Technology alone will not simplify workflow management unless institutions establish governance around process ownership and decision rights. Each major workflow should have a business owner, measurable service expectations, and documented approval logic. Admissions should define response-time standards and document completeness rules. Finance should define billing controls, reconciliation cadence, and exception handling. Procurement should define approval thresholds, preferred vendor policies, and receiving procedures. HR should define onboarding, contract, and employee record standards. Facilities should define maintenance priorities, preventive schedules, and escalation rules.
Leadership should also review a consistent set of operational indicators across departments. Examples include inquiry-to-application conversion, invoice aging, procurement cycle time, stock availability for critical supplies, employee onboarding completion, helpdesk resolution time, and maintenance backlog. Odoo ERP supports this governance model by making workflow status and transactional data visible in one environment, which improves accountability and reduces dependence on manually compiled reports.
Scalability recommendations for growing education organizations
Education institutions often underestimate how quickly administrative complexity grows with enrollment, program diversification, and campus expansion. A scalable ERP design should therefore prioritize reusable process templates, standardized master data, and modular deployment. New campuses should not create entirely new workflows unless regulatory or business requirements demand it. Instead, institutions should define common process blueprints for admissions, procurement, finance, HR, and service operations, then allow controlled local variations where necessary.
Scalability also depends on reporting architecture. Leadership should be able to analyze performance by campus, department, program, or legal entity without rebuilding reports manually. Institutions planning long-term growth should design chart of accounts structures, approval hierarchies, inventory locations, service categories, and document taxonomies with expansion in mind. AI and automation opportunities in education ERP
AI should be introduced in education operations where it improves decision support, reduces repetitive administrative effort, or strengthens service responsiveness. In an Odoo-centered environment, AI can assist with applicant inquiry classification, automated response suggestions, document extraction, invoice data capture, anomaly detection in procurement or expense patterns, and prioritization of support tickets. For finance and operations leaders, AI can also support forecasting for enrollment-related revenue, procurement demand, staffing needs, and maintenance trends when historical data quality is strong.
The most effective approach is to layer AI onto already standardized workflows. If admissions stages, procurement approvals, or service categories are inconsistent, AI outputs will be less reliable. Institutions should first establish clean process structures in Odoo ERP, then introduce targeted automation and intelligence capabilities that support measurable outcomes such as faster response times, lower administrative effort, improved collections, or better resource planning.
